  1. The Herschel Walker trade was the largest player trade in the history of the National Football League (NFL). This deal on October 12, 1989, centered on sending running back Herschel Walker from the Dallas Cowboys to the Minnesota Vikings.

  2. Jan 31, 2022 · The largest trade in NFL history — by sheer size and impact — was the one centered around running back Herschel Walker that took place between the Minnesota Vikings and Dallas Cowboys in October 1989. It involved an unprecedented (wait for it...) 18 players and NFL Draft picks.
